I am currently recruiting for a HR Business Analyst in South East London.

This is an exciting opportunity to join an organisation which is growing and is investing within its HR Function. This is a new role which will report into the HR Director. The purpose of the role is to develop and deliver an effective modern integrated HR IT solution for the growing needs of the business.

The successful candidate will have extensive experience of computer system operations and have experience of implementing a HR IT system within a large organisation. They must have project management experience and experience of developing training plans for the implementation of the system.

RESPONSIBILITIES

• Under direction, serve as a liaison between the Human Resources (HR) and Information Technology (IT) Departments to provide systems support and analysis and to leverage technology solutions to meet the needs of the HR Department and users of HR information systems
• Work with all levels of HR staff in assessing needs for various business functions. Assist management in identifying and analysing options and recommends business process enhancements.
• Works with HR staff in the development of project scope of work documents and project plans that include analysis of cost, benefit, work schedule, related risks and return on investment.
• Provides project oversight from design through implementation. Identifies, tracks, monitors and communicates on project-related issues, scope changes, variances and contingencies that occur during the course of projects. Monitors project work to ensure that progress is maintained within expected guidelines and is completed on a timely basis.
• Creates test scenarios and assists project team members in performing tests to ensure all processes work according to predetermined goals.
• Works with functional areas to identify roles of project team members, project reporting structures, frequency of interaction and training requirements.
• Assists team members in identifying reports that are needed by the department and users of HR information.
• Participates in IT Status meetings for identification and resolution of issues and consideration and evaluation of potential system enhancements and upgrades.
• Assists HR project team members with technical issues related to the HR IT system by investigating problems and developing detailed suggestions for resolution of issues.
• Maintains familiarity with all computer systems used in the department, utilising them as needed, evaluating their effectiveness and making recommendations for enhancements.
• Assists in developing training plans and training documents. Assists in training HR Department staff and others utilising HR computer systems, supervising staff closely in implementation phases of new systems.
